A Fast Simplex Algorithm for Linear Programming

Ping-Qi Pan(panpq***at***seu.edu.cn)

Abstract: Recently, computational results demonstrated the superiority of a so-called ``largest-distance'' rule and ``nested pricing'' rule to other major rules commonly used in practice. A simplex algorithm using a combination of the two successful rules was implemented, and tested on the same 80 large-scale problems from Netlib, Kennington and BPMPD test sets. The outcome turned out to be very favorable.

Keywords: large-scale linear programming, simplex algorithm, pivot rule, nested, largest-distance, scaling.
